Limburgse vlaai is the region’s signature fruit or rice pie, long baked for birthdays and coffee tables across South Limburg.
Zoervleisj is a sweet-sour Limburg beef stew, slowly braised with vinegar and syrup, traditionally served with fries or bread.
Nonnevotten are festive twisted dough pastries from Limburg, deep-fried and coated with sugar, especially popular at carnival time.

Moderate for the Netherlands: hotels and dining are cheaper than Amsterdam, while local transit and groceries are fairly priced for visitors.
Service is usually included. Round up or leave 5-10% for good restaurant service. Taxis are often rounded up. In cafes, small change is enough.
